EDITORS COMMENTS
This pastel drawing of Charles Darwin, depicting the renowned naturalist in deep thought, was created by the skilled hand of English artist Samuel Laurence. The portrait captures Darwin in his later years, with a furrowed brow and intense gaze, reflecting the profound depth of his intellectual curiosity and groundbreaking discoveries. The setting for this poignant image is Downe House in Kent, where Darwin spent the final years of his life, surrounded by the natural beauty of the English countryside that had inspired much of his work. Charles Darwin (1809-1882) is widely regarded as one of the most influential figures in scientific history. His groundbreaking theory of evolution by natural selection, presented in his seminal work "On the Origin of Species," revolutionized the way we understand the natural world and our place within it. Darwin's ideas challenged the established beliefs of his time and continue to shape our understanding of biology, ecology, and the interconnectedness of all living organisms. This beautiful pastel drawing by Samuel Laurence offers a glimpse into the private world of this brilliant and enigmatic man, providing a poignant reminder of the enduring impact of Darwin's groundbreaking ideas on science and our understanding of the natural world.
